Preliminary Management Decisions
It takes an especially dedicated person to live in a house while it is being renovated. If you intend to do this, you must have a minimum set of working facilities such as bathroom and kitchen in order to occupy a residence. Since most gut rehabs take between 6-12 months to acquire, finance, design, and construct, people generally prefer to maintain an alternate residence during construction.
Plan out what you will do if the project takes longer than expected, or contractors are difficult to schedule when you need them. The summer months when everyone is working on house projects are typically a contractors’ busiest.
Your Involvement
You must determine the extent to which you want to be involved in the process. Things to consider while making this decision include:
- How much “sweat equity” can you contribute? You can save money by doing some of the non-structural demolition yourself (plaster, non-structural walls, old wiring, old plumbing, etc). Other things that are relatively easy to learn are painting, tiling, cabinet installation, and hardware installation.
- Can you serve as general contractor? The general contractor gets bids for work, coordinates sub-contractors, verifies workmanship, and makes sure that work is performed per plans.
- What is your decision-making process?You will be expected to make numerous decisions regarding finishes such as counters, cabinets, colors, fixtures, carpet, etc. The more reading and research you do beforehand, the better equipped you will be to make informed decisions.
